Product Definition Definition of approved item name (AIN): "AXLE,VEHICULAR,NONDRIVING"
An item designed for connecting the opposite wheels and supporting the weight of a vehicle without provisions for driving the wheels. It may have pivoting wheel spindles for steering. Excludes axle, railway and wheel set, railway.
